Abstract
This paper proposes a novel distance measuring scheme based on repeated PN sequence for ultra wide-band vehicle radar systems. The proposed scheme measures the distance between a vehicle and an obstacle based on repeated use of a single short pseudo random sequence. Simulation results show that the proposed scheme provides a shorter mean distance measuring time while keeping a similar measurement error performance to that of the conventional scheme. © 2011 IEEE.
